Terri Kaiser: A Volleyball Legend Celebrating Community and Commitment

Lake Worth Beach, USA - On July 14, 2025, Lake Worth Christian celebrated a remarkable season for its girls‘ volleyball team, highlighted by a touching address from head coach Terri Kaiser during the „Volley for the Cause“ event. This gathering not only spotlighted the team’s success but also served as a poignant reminder of Kaiser’s personal battle with breast cancer, a struggle she bravely faced while continuing to coach her athletes.
Kaiser, who has devoted 37 years to enhancing the volleyball program, stands out as a beacon of commitment and passion. Under her leadership, Lake Worth Christian has garnered more Player of the Year awards and state championships than any other school in Palm Beach County over the past 25 years. In addition, Kaiser has celebrated significant milestones, including leading her teams to five state championships and four runner-up finishes while achieving over 600 career victories, as noted in CBS 12.
A Legacy Built on Development and Loyalty
Kaiser emphasizes that volleyball is the ultimate team sport, one that not only requires skill but also dedication and loyalty among players. She nurtures athletes who often remain in the program for over two years, helping them develop not just as players but as well-rounded individuals. “Loyalty is key,” she asserts, reflecting on the community she’s built at Lake Worth Christian, where all four of her children also attended.
The importance of player development is a central theme in Kaiser’s coaching philosophy. She has fostered a year-round commitment to training, adapting as volleyball evolves. “The rules of the game keep changing, and to stay competitive, you need to be dedicated,” Kaiser commented, underlining the rigorous demands of the sport.
